Keep Your Plants Healthy and Thriving + Pest Control

Tips for Plant Care

Keeping your plants healthy and thriving is essential for a beautiful and vibrant garden. Here are some tips to help you achieve that:

1. Watering

Ensure your plants receive the right amount of water. Overwatering can lead to root rot, while underwatering can cause wilting. Find the balance that works best for each plant.

2. Sunlight

Most plants need sunlight to thrive. Make sure your plants are placed in locations where they can get adequate sunlight based on their specific light requirements.

3. Soil Quality

Use well-draining soil that is rich in nutrients. Good soil quality is crucial for the overall health of your plants.

Pest Control

Dealing with pests is a common challenge for plant lovers. Here are some natural ways to control pests and keep your plants safe:

1. Neem Oil

Neem oil is a natural insecticide that can help control common garden pests like aphids, mealybugs, and spider mites. Dilute it with water and spray it on your plants.

2. Ladybugs

Introduce ladybugs into your garden as they feed on aphids and other harmful insects, acting as a natural pest control method.

3. Diatomaceous Earth

Diatomaceous earth is a natural powder that can help eliminate pests like slugs, snails, and ants. Sprinkle it around the base of your plants to create a barrier.
